Abstract
A systematic study of retrograde atrial activation sequence at commonly used electrode catheter recording sites in 8 patients without, and in 4 patients with AV nodal re entrant paroxysmal tachycardia was made. During right ventricular pacing, the retrograde atrial activation sequence was low septal right atrium - proximal coronary sinus - distal coronary sinus - high right atrium. During the episodes of paroxysmal tachycardia, a similar pattern was observed. This information should be helpful in the understanding of abnormal activation sequences in patients with paroxysmal supraventricular tachycardia in whom retrogradely conducting anomalous pathways are suspected.
